To interpret this data gathered from students, numeracy experiences the author use the

hypothetical mean range and verbal description.

Hypothetical Mean Range

Numerical Equivalence Description

4.21-5.00 Always

3.41-4.20 Often

2.61-3.40 Sometimes
1.81-2.60 Rarely

1.00-1.80 Never
